Living things in an area together with the nonliving surroundings form an:

AEmbankment
BEcosystem
CEscarpment
DEnclosure
Answer & Solution
Correct answer: B. Ecosystem
1. A community counts only the living part. 2. Adding soil, water and climate completes the picture. 3. That whole is an ecosystem. _Source: OpenStax Biology 2e, Chapter 44, Ecology and the Biosphere._
